TDP campaign vehicle set on fire

NOB_TDP campaign vehicle set on fire by two unkown people

NOB-Annamaya news: The incident where thugs set fire to the campaign vehicle of Telugu Desam Party took place in Annamaiya district of Andhra Pradesh state. A campaign vehicle of TDP was poured petrol and set on fire at Vitthalam in Valmikipuram mandal of the district. While the driver was in the vehicle, the assailants set fire to the vehicle and fled from there. The vehicle was completely burnt in this incident. On 27.04.2024, two miscreants on a bike without a number plate poured petrol on the campaign chariot and set it on fire. The driver was seriously injured in the accident. Locals noticed him and took him to the hospital for treatment. After learning about the matter, the TDP leaders staged a sit-in agitation on the national highway. Local CI Pulisekhar told the TDP officials and promised to arrest the accused and the agitation ended. About 2 km, many vehicles stopped due to this agitation, the staff under the direction of local SS Venkateswarlu took action.
